Ours last a long time. We have many in our home becuz we have older dogs and do not want them to slip. We also have no carpeting in our home. We launder in our machine on delicate and cold water w/Woolite type detergent,rinse w/ white vinegar and hang to dry in the furnace room. We buy many at Goodwill. The ones from Goodwill are new(you can tell) .
